Sailing and Canoing on Lake Jindabyne
Learn to sail or canoe on a variety of watercrafts with local instructors and all safety equipment included. Jindabyne Lake is a perfect area for those who love to try new water sports and with a capacity of 386,282 Megalitres you and your friends will have plenty of space to try your new sport without feeling cramped.

Snowy Mountains Touring Company
Tours start from Jindabyne and go to Khancoban and Yarrangobilly Caves. If you've got a group no problems, Snowy Mountains Touring Company also do tours by arrangement where you can take your own car if you have a small group or take the 25 seater coach.

Climbing & Abseiling
Fancy getting horizontal on the side of a cliff? then Abseiling is for you. Thredbo and Jindabyne Damn Wall offer fantastic views of the high country and what better way to see it by working your way down some of the massive granite boulders and terrain. Each step of the way you will have an experienced guide and instructor with you who show you the ropes and guarantee your safe and that you have a blast!
Abseiling costs from around $95 for a half day through to $160 for a full day climbing.
Thredbo also has a Traverse Climbing wall which costs $8.00 and is open 7 days a week.
Crackenback Cottage & Maze
Stop in at the Southern Hemisphere's largest wooden maze and explore your way back to the cottage for a bite to eat.Maze entry is $2. The restaurant is open for morning and afternoon tea, lunch, dinner and snacks. There is also a great gift shop stocked with treats and speciality gifts including local made jams. Warm
